Panaji: After a recent victory over two sports venues, Santa Cruz is now eyeing the jurisdiction of the Cujira integrated school complex at Bambolim. “The integrated school complex at Cujira is also in the jurisdiction of Santa Cruz, just as the two stadiums were,” said panch Inacio Dominic Pereira.
“The revenue generated from these properties must rightfully come to the Santa Cruz panchayat. We have already initiated conversations with the director of education to address this issue, seeking to update the official address to reflect Santa Cruz as the rightful governing authority,” he said.
This move follows a successful turf battle involving the jurisdiction of two important sports venues — the Athletics Stadium at Cujira, which was named under the St Andre constituency, and the Dr Shyama Prasad Mukherjee Stadium located at Goa University, which was named under the Taleigao constituency. The office of the mamlatdar for the Tiswadi taluka recently confirmed jurisdictional details for both sports venues as Santa Cruz after receiving formal requests from the Sports Authority of Goa (SAG).
“The file to recognise the two stadiums as coming under Santa Cruz is with govt. The official handover to the panchayat is pending. If required, we will meet sports minister Govind Gaude in this regard,” Pereira said.
Even though it has been a decade since the inauguration of the two stadiums, efforts will be made to recover lost revenue. “If it is possible to recover the previously lost arrears, we will write to govt on this,” Pereira said.
